Output 70c2903024b1ba2a3aecb4b65ebea2849a63de343885a8a0b9bf41d1351a2eda:0

value
12102555
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ddf5415f6bd29330b4771c02bfc8ab33254a7301 OP_EQUALVERIFY OP_CHECKSIG
address
1MEc935YsoNY1otHU4KnRjpU6ZASWjSiuG
transaction
70c2903024b1ba2a3aecb4b65ebea2849a63de343885a8a0b9bf41d1351a2eda
spent
true